Output 572dc0281c758ea119e86cd9400a464f72f00a333e4d112b70e777c32e0daf32:7

value
344672
script pubkey
OP_0 OP_PUSHBYTES_32 6caf529c95745a792101a192021db406d32ae7071e9d57e1b7b3addafe85d51e
address
bc1qdjh498y4w3d8jggp5xfqy8d5qmfj4ec8r6w40cdhkwka4l59650q43euqd
transaction
572dc0281c758ea119e86cd9400a464f72f00a333e4d112b70e777c32e0daf32
confirmations
24857
spent
true